      *Feature Overview

      How much can we upstream into leapp so that the RHEL upgrade is ‘normal’ with no special caveats?
      What do we need to do to get our packages/repositories into the leapp repomap, etc?
      Wrap or don’t wrap leapp in edpm-ansible playbooks.
      If we do, we should collaborate with RHEL rather than roll our own. See RHELBU-3269 Create a System Role for Upgrades (scheduled for release in RHEL 9.8 GA)
      Cater for any EDPM host, including Networker, Storage (Ceph/Swift), Compute
      How do we feel about allowing customers to co-ordinate system upgrades via external tools (Satellite, AAP, gitlab, jenkins), rather than forcing our own methods?
      TODO need feedback from PM about UX and requirements
      Ansible roles compatibility in RHEL9 and RHEL10 (different versions of ansible, python, libs)
